2.2 MIDI MENU TWEAKS
+
All of the following are accessible under the MIDI menu. Any edits made in the Global
or MIDI menu are remembered; the next time you turn on the DPM V3, any changes
made to these menus will be retained, even if Memory Protect (described earlier) is
on. The general protocol is:
1. Press the MIDI master button. This is not necessary if you are already in the MIDI
menu.
2. Select the desired page.
3. Use the Right/Left buttons to choose the parameter to be modified.
4. Select the parameter value.
2.2a Set Middle C (36 to 84)
You can offset Middle C to any note within the MIDI note range of 36 to 84 (60 is
the default for middle C). Think of this as a "global transposition" option.
1. Select the MIDI Ovf/MidC/Xctrl page.
2. Press the Right or Left Arrow until the MidC parameter flashes.
3. Select the desired amount of transposition.
